Problems solved by technology

[0004] At present, the problems existing in the preparation process of azlocillin sodium sulbactam sodium compound preparations are: 1) there is no mixed product of azlocillin sodium sulbactam sodium on the market at present, which cannot meet the needs of the market; The preparation method of sodium and sulbactam sodium is a solvent method, which is complicated in technology and high in cost, which is unfavorable for industrialized production
3) At present, the batching process of similar products on the market is to use sodium bicarbonate to achieve acid-base neutralization reaction. Using sodium bicarbonate will generate a large amount of carbon dioxide foam, and it will easily lead to the phenomenon of rushing when the material is added too fast, and it needs to be vacuumed to remove carbon dioxide. The process is cumbersome and difficult to control

Abstract

The invention discloses a preparation method of azlocillin sodium-sulbactam sodium for injection. The preparation method comprises the following steps: dropwise adding an alkaline solution of sodium hydroxide and less sodium carbonate, reacting with azlocillin and sulbactam, quickly reducing the temperature of reaction feed liquid to -45 DEG C, stabilizing for 1 to 2 hours and pre-freezing; carrying out three-stage sublimation drying and desorption drying, rising the pressure, cooling after testing is qualified, and discharging the azlocillin sodium sulbactam sodium out of a box after deflating to reach normal pressure. According to the preparation method disclosed by the invention, by adopting the modes of buffering the sodium hydroxide by adopting the sodium carbonate, controlling reaction temperature and the like, degradation of materials due to sharp reaction of the sodium hydroxide and excessive concentration of the sodium hydroxide can be effectively prevented, and the problem that a large amount of foam is generated due to the adoption of the sodium hydrogen carbonate can also be avoided; in a pre-freezing stage, a quick freezing mode is adopted, so that feed liquid can be rapidly crystallized, and generation of impurities can be reduced; finally, the azlocillin sodium-sulbactam sodium for injection in which the contents of azlocillin sodium and sulbactam sodium accord with the requirements and of which the storage stability is good can be obtained through a freeze drying method.

Description

technical field [0001] The invention relates to a preparation method of azlocillin sodium and sulbactam sodium for injection, which belongs to the technical field of medicine. Background technique [0002] Azlocillin sodium is a semi-synthetic ureide penicillin, pioneered by the United Kingdom, and has been clinically applied in Germany, the United Kingdom, the United States, Japan and other countries. It is effective against Gram-positive bacteria and negative bacteria, especially Pseudomonas aeruginosa. antibacterial effect.
